## 3.2.0 — Changed defaults

Scrubber (image EXIF pipeline) now strips all metadata by default, including GPS, serial numbers, and embedded thumbnails. Previously only GPS tags were removed. Opt-in allowlisting replaces the old denylist model; any tag not explicitly allowed is dropped. ICC profiles are preserved to avoid color shifts. This closes the metadata-leak finding from the last audit cycle. Uploads processed before this release are not retroactively scrubbed. The new default configuration shipped with this release is shown below.

config for yagag-baduf:
DRUAEL_LOG_LEVEL=debug
DRUAEL_METRICS_HOST=metrics.druael.zemvarworks.corp
DRUAEL_POOL_SIZE=16

## Onboarding — Markdown Pipeline (Inkmere)

Inkmere docs render through a three-stage pipeline: parse, sanitize, emit. Releases rebuild all templates; never hot-patch emitted HTML. Broken renders usually mean a sanitizer rule change — check the rules diff first. The render cluster only accepts builds from the release channel, and every build artifact must be signed before upload. Sign artifacts with the deploy key below.

release key, hafop-tajef: bky13_s2vaFVNJTHfBL

Finance Review Summary — Proposed Joint Venture with Bramley Holt Industrial

The review panel assessed the proposed 60/40 joint venture between Corvane Systems and Bramley Holt to manufacture the Aldric pump line in Westmarch. Projected payback is 4.2 years, within policy. Capital exposure is capped at the first-phase tooling spend, and exit clauses were deemed adequate. Working-capital assumptions remain optimistic and require a second pass by Treasury before signature. The strategic rationale rests on one consideration set out below.

board note of bajeg-tahop: The southern region missed its Sorir quota by 52.8 percent last quarter. Queniusek Partners plans to raise the Aldax list price by 16.2 percent in July. The finance team signed off on a budget of $433.3 million for Project Keleth. The renewal with Ulaielek Group closes at $146.1 million a year, 37.2 percent above the last contract.